了解网络协议的工作机制网络协议是如何相互通讯的

时间:2025-12-06 分类:网络技术

网络协议是互联网通信的基石,它们定义了数据如何在不同设备之间传输并确保信息的有效交互。随着互联网技术的不断发展,网络协议的种类也在不断增加,从早期的简单协议到如今复杂的多层协议体系,了解这些协议的工作机制对于网络工程师和开发者来说至关重要。本文将深入探讨网络协议的基本概念、主要类型及其如何实现相互通信,帮助读者对网络数据传输有一个更清晰的认识。

了解网络协议的工作机制网络协议是如何相互通讯的

网络协议可以被看作是不同计算机之间进行交流的一种语言。每一种协议都有自己的语法和语义,确保信息能够在发送方和接收方之间准确传递。最常见的网络协议包括TCP/IP、HTTP、FTP等。TCP/IP协议族是互联网的核心协议,负责数据分组的传输,而HTTP则广泛应用于网页浏览,帮助用户获取内容。

不同协议之间是如何相互通信的呢?其实,协议之间的交互依赖于"协议栈"的概念。每个协议都有其独特的功能,并通常在一个多层的结构中工作。例如,HTTP协议就建立在TCP协议之上,HTTP负责处理应用层的数据请求,而TCP则确保数据在网络传输过程中不会丢失。这种层次化的设计使得协议间可以互相协作,但又能独立工作,实现了不同网络应用的有效连接。

网络协议的标准化对于确保不同设备间的兼容性至关重要。国际标准化组织(ISO)及其他组织制定了许多网络协议的标准,使得来自不同厂商的设备能够无缝工作。这些标准不仅提升了网络的互操作性,还促进了互联网技术的普及与发展。

网络协议在复杂的互联网中发挥着重要的作用。了解它们的工作机制和相互之间的关系,不仅能帮助技术人员优化网络性能,也能为普通用户提供更好地使用网络的基础。未来,随着技术的进步,新型网络协议的出现将继续丰富和深化这一领域,为全球的网络交流带来更多可能。